Photography Interest Group – Singapore River Walk (17.03.2012)

For the next photo field trip, we will start from Raffles Place MRT, detour a bit and walk along the underground Marina Bay Link Mall in the vicinity of the "2nd" Financial Centre and coming up The Promontory. Here we have a good view of Marina Bay Sands Integrated Resort. 

From here we walk along Marina Bay to the Merlion Park. We pass the historic Fullerton Building (now a high-end Hotel), Cavenagh Bridge, the Fullerton Heritage, Empress Place, Sir Stamford Raffles statue, Victoria Theatre (now under re-construction), Asian Civilization Museum, Parliament House, Elgin & Coleman Bridges, colorful MICA building, Boat and Clark Quay, Read Bridge, before ending the walk in Liang Court shopping mall.
